IYF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

315 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ares US Financials ETF (IYF)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$877M — down 21% from $1.11B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 50 funds closed out of IYF and 25 opened new positions — a net loss of 25 holders — while 116 trimmed existing stakes and 81 added.

The largest buyer was Prudential Financial, adding an estimated $8.22M. The largest seller was Kellett Wealth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$11.4M sold.
